For this International Women Day we decided to resurrect older Twitter thread and compile a list of record labels run by women. Feel free to suggest any labels we missed in comment section!

100% Silk – run by Amanda Brown
Aerocade – run by Meerenai Shim (suggested by And Otherness/Greg Skloff)
Bastard Girls – suggested by Tendencyitis
Dubbed Tapes – run by GinOnDiamonds
Eye Vybe Records – run by Karissa Talanian (suggested by Kris Thompson)
Figureight Records – run by Hildur Maral
Flaming Pines – run by Kate Carr
Injazero Records – run by Sine Büyüka
Kissability – run by Jen Long (suggested by Third Kind Tapes)
Monika Enterprise – run by Gudrun Gut (suggested by Petridisch)
Morpheus Revisited – run by Emily Loren – new label, no releases yet, but some promises
Objects Limited – run by Lara Rix-Martin
Punk in my Vitamins – run by Courtney K
Rocket Girl – run by Vinita Joshi
Saffron Records – run by Laura Lewis-Paul
Sargent House – run by Cathy Pellow
Sofia Records – run by Natalia Beylis
Spinster – run by Sarah Louise, Emily Hilliard and Sally Morgan
Stargazer Records – run by Isabel Parzich
Thrill Jockey – run by Bettina Richards
Tormenta Electrica – run by Deborah Machado (suggested by Ondness)
Track and Field – run by Kate Davis (suggested by Z Tapes / Filip)
Translinguistic Other – run by Emily Pothast
Xylem Records – run by Norah Lorway (suggested by Phantom Circuit)
